2. ACTIVE TEST
HINT:
Using the Techstream to perform Active Tests allows relays, VSVs, actuators and other items to be
operated without removing any parts. This non-intrusive functional inspection can be very useful
because intermittent operation may be discovered before parts or wiring is disturbed. Performing Active
Tests early in troubleshooting is one way to save diagnostic time. Data List information can be displayed
while performing Active Tests.
(a) Warm up the engine.
(b) Turn the ignition switch off.
(c) Connect the Techstream to the DLC3.
(d) Turn the ignition switch to ON.
(e) Turn the Techstream on.
(f) Enter the following menus: Powertrain / Engine and ECT / Active Test.
(g) According to the display on the Techstream, perform the Active Test.
